Location
Thorndon is a delightful village set in North Suffolk and enjoys excellent countryside walks. Eye being the closest historic town nearby which offers an assortment of local shops and businesses. The local schooling is highly thought of with Nursery to High School ages catered for. Services include health centre, butchers, bakers, deli, supermarkets and chemist amongst others. The market town of Diss (approximately 7 miles away) offers an extensive range of further amenities. Diss also benefits from a mainline rail service which runs between the City of Norwich and London's Liverpool Street Station.
